Disappearing iOS mail signature images

Suddenly, over the last 3 or 4 days, my iPhone and iPad signature is missing the image.


I keep deleting the old signature and try to re-paste it, and it shows up for a short time, then disappears. My text still show up, but the image keep disappearing.


It's always worked fine before, but now I can't figure out what the problem is. Any ideas?

Thought I'd post another little tidbit. It is VERY easy to replicate the problem;

1. Start with a fresh boot / launch of the iPad.

2. Copy the email signature, inclusive of the image you want. Mine happens to be the one I created on my MacBook which I get from an existing email.

3. Go to Settings> General>Mail, Contacts, Calendars>Signatures and paste the signature there.

4. Switch back to the mail app via multi tasking and click the new mail icon.

5. The signature inclusive of the image (correctly) appears.

6. Completely close the Mail and Settings applications.

7. Open the Mail app once again and repeat step #4

8. The signature now appears EXCLUSIVE of the image. It is instead replaced with a white box with a thin black border.


I can reproduce this at will. Apple: Again, please fix this!

After much time messing around with this I figured out the issue. It is the way WinDoze (Outlook) formats the HTML E-Mail signature!


I tried publishing an HTML through many ways and it always lost the pictures and sometimes even the formatting. I knew I needed to get it into an Apple compatible format but could not figure out how, copying it just copies the text and leaves out the pictures so here is what I did!


1. Copy the entire signature from an existing E-Mail. (or create your own)

2. Paste it into TextEdit.

3. Save it as a RichText document.

4. Open the document and select the entire signature.

5. Open Mail and paste the signature into a new E-Mail.

6. Send it to yourself.

7. Open that Email on your iPhone. (or iPad) {I have not tried it on an iPad but I assume it will work the same}

8. Click on your signature and "Select All".

9. Go into Settings>Mail, Contacts, Calenders>Signature.

10. Click on the account you want to use or use all accounts.

11. Paste the text into the box.

12. Shake your iPhone and click on "Undo Change Attributes". <--VERY important! (It updates the formatting when pasting)

13. Send an E-Mail and check out your awesome new signature!
